Summary

Child and spousal support; vocational experts. Allows a court to appoint a vocational expert to conduct an evaluation of a party in cases involving child support, spousal support, and separate maintenance where the earning capacity, unemployment, or underemployment of a party is in controversy. The court may award costs or fees for the evaluation and the services of the expert at any time during the proceedings.
